Ferretti Group launches a new line

Having already come together in the 1970s, CRN and Riva, both of which are part of the Ferretti Group, have renewed their marriage vows with a new line of 50 to 80-metre yachts.

Mauro Micheli and Officina Italiana Design will continue to do the design work, melding the inimitable Riva style with CRN of Ancona’s technical excellence.

The first model, unveiled at the 2009 Monaco Yacht Show, was a 68-metre four-decker brimming with personality. The rest of the range will also retain the signature Riva elegance despite being as high tech as they come. The result will be, of course, a whole string of new classics.
